Moodmark Painter

Creature — Human Shaman

Undergrowth — When Moodmark Painter enters the battlefield, target creature gains menace and gets +X/+0 until end of turn where X is the number of creatures cards in your graveyard. (It can't be blocked except by two or more creatures.)

Hey, nice prerelease sealed deck, but a deck like this doesn't translate well to Standard.

This is fine list of cards you want to play in Standard, but it's not yet a finished deck. Starting out making a list of cards is good, everyone starts out doing this, but the next step is to narrow down the list. Keep the good cards and cut the rest. For Standard decks don't build them like sealed decks. You can use up to four copies of a card in a Standard deck and you have freedom to play the better cards and cut the least good cards.

For example here cards like Glowspore Shaman, Kraul Harpooner, Golgari Findbroker, Underrealm Lich, Izoni, Thousand-Eyed, Find / Finality, Status / Statue even Swarm Guildmage are all good cards for Standard. Why are they good cards for Standard? They either give you value when ETB (enters the battlefield) (Glowspore, Findbroker). Have good stats (power and toughness) for their mana cost (Hapooner, Glowspore). They can win you the game if not answered right away (Lich, Izoni) or they give you a lot of options for a single card (Status, Find).

In contrast cards like Child of Night, Moodmark Painter, Hired Poisoner, Erstwhile Trooper, Grappling Sundew, Deadly Visit, etc. are not cards for Standard because there's many other cards that cost the same that are better options.

I don't want to tell you how to make your deck. I'm simply giving you some advice of how to improve it for Standard. In Standard you can also play cards from other sets. In Guilds of Ravnica Standard which starts Oct. 5th you can also play cards from sets: Ixalan, Rivals of Ixalan, Core Set 2019 (M19) and Dominaria. Using cards from all these sets and cards from Guilds of Ravnica you can build a good budget casual Golgari Standard deck with only uncommon/common cards with a sprinkling of rares/mythics that you have.

Here are three strong budget cards for Golgari: Dusk Legion Zealot, Plaguecrafter and Ravenous Chupacabra.
